> I just committed a patch that writes debug messages to a logfile.
> 
> If you start qmapshack with the commandline option "-f" a logfile "
> org.qlandkarte.QMapShack.log"
> will be created in the system's temporary folder.
> 
> If there are error messages when loading tiles they will be printed to
> that file.

> "depreciated" says that the module might be gone with Qt6. But it will
> be supported in all Qt5 versions. Up to now there is no other module
> replacing the functionality of QtScript. So it's a bit strange to
> depreciate it without a real plan B. Anyway let's wait for Qt6. It
> wouldn't be the first time for a depreciated feature having a great
> come
> back (e.g. QPointer)
